A Universally Valid Uncertainty Relation Revisited
Abstract
A universally valid uncertainty relation proposed by Ozawa is re-investigated under for the generalized equation of motion with some boundary condition. Necessary conditions for violation (lessening) of the Heisenberg-type uncertainty relation is discussed in detail. An experimental test of lessening of the generalized uncertainty relation due to the boundary condition is shown by re-analyzing the data measuring electron densities of hydrogen molecule encapsulated in a cage of fullerene C60.
